Introduction Airbnb is an online community marketplace that connects people looking to rent their homes with

people who are looking for accommodations.

Airbnb users include hosts and travellers: hosts list and rent out their unused spaces, and travellers search for and book accommodations in 192 countries worldwide.

It's free to create a listing, and hosts decide how much to charge per night, per week or per month.

Each listing allows hosts to promote properties through titles, descriptions, photographs with captions and a user profile where potential guests can get to know a bit about the hosts.

Travellers (or "guests") search the available database of properties by entering details about when and where they'd like to travel. Travellers can further refine searches by making selections for: Room type, size, price, amenities etc.

Merits to the Customer The consumer (host) can earn extra money from his property when not in use.

The travellers (guests) can get the feeling of staying at home, often at a cheaper rate as compared to the expensive hotels.

Host Guarantee program provides protection for up to $1,000,000 .

Both hosts and guests can help limit risks by using Airbnb features including Verified IDs, profiles, reviews, messaging, secure payment platform and the Host Guarantee.

Demerits to the Customer The biggest risk for hosts is that their property will get damaged.

In order to avail the ‘Host Guarantee Program’ it's important to read the terms and conditions to fully understand what's covered, what's not covered (things such as cash, rare artwork, jewellery and pets aren’t covered) And also the steps a host must take to seek payment under the Host Guarantee.

The Travellers pay a guest service fee of 6-12% on top of the reservation to cover services such as customer support and the Host Guarantee.

In addition to that AIRBNB takes 3% service fee from the host for each reservation to cover the cost of processing the transaction.

The business doesn’t check whether the information regarding the property entered by the host is correct. This forms a major risk for its guests.

The site doesn’t provide any information regarding the ‘State and Local Laws’. Thus the travellers have to gather and understand these law by themselves.
